Bike Dissected: Serco Yamaha YZ250F

Serco Yamaha always have some of the freshest looking bikes in the MX Nationals (MXN) pit paddock, and this year is no exception. With Yamaha supporting four teams on the MXN start line across MX1, MX2 and MXD, we asked the crew at Serco Yamaha to give us a rundown of the trick parts their two riders – Nathan Crawford and Aaron Tanti – are sporting on their YZ250F this race season.

The Rundown

Motor

Head: Serco Motorsport
Piston: Wossner
Cams: Hotcams
ECU: Vortex

Exhaust: Yoshimura
Fuel: VP Roo 100
Spark Plug: NGK
Engine Covers: GYTR

Chassis

Fork: KYB
Shock: KYB
Linkage: OEM

Triple Clamps: X-Trig
Handlebars: Pro Taper
Grips: Pro Taper
Levers: Pro Taper

Chain: Pro Taper
Wheels: DID/EZI/Ash Spoked Wheels
Rotors: Galfer
Tyres: Dunlop

Seat Cover: Factory Effex
Carbon Parts:  CRM
Graphics: Serco Custom MX  Decals
